Ministry of Economy and Finance Holds Korean Economy Briefing for 81 Foreign Embassies in Korea
Announcement of Korea New Deal Strategy and Discussions on Economic Cooperation Plans with Various Countries
[Sejong=Asia Economy Reporter Moon Chaeseok] On the 31st, the Ministry of Economy and Finance held the 2nd Korea Economic Briefing for Foreign Missions in Korea via video conference. It was two months after the 1st meeting on January 28.
At this briefing, attended by 125 ambassadors and charg?s d'affaires from 81 countries' missions in Korea, the Ministry announced the Korean New Deal implementation strategy, this year's plans for the 'Knowledge Sharing Program (KSP) on Economic Development Experience' and the 'Economic Innovation Partnership Program (EIPP),' and conducted a Q&A session. The KSP refers to a knowledge-sharing project that provides policy formulation and institutional improvement advice to developing countries. The EIPP is a project that offers in-depth consultations on about five cases annually for over three years, focusing on specific sectors such as large-scale infrastructure development.

A Ministry of Economy and Finance official stated, "Participants showed interest in the detailed implementation strategy of the Korean New Deal and sharing Korea's economic development experience, expressing hope to strengthen cooperation in related fields in the future."
